What are the main differences and advantages between your industrial liquid painting services and powder coating services for metal components in terms of durability, finish quality, and cost-effectiveness?
Industrial liquid paint offers great flexibility in terms of colours, appearance and thickness. It is particularly suitable for complex parts, small production runs and specific aesthetic requirements.
Powder coating is characterised by its mechanical robustness, good resistance to external aggressions and excellent repeatability in series production. It is often a durable and competitive solution for large volumes and standardised applications.
The choice between liquid and powder paint depends on the geometry of the parts, aesthetic requirements, exposure conditions and overall cost objectives.
What types of surface preparation (e.g., blasting, chemical cleaning, phosphating) do you recommend and provide before applying industrial paint coatings to ensure optimal adhesion and long-term corrosion protection?
Surface preparation is an essential step in ensuring the adhesion and durability of industrial paints.
Depending on the material, surface condition and usage requirements, it may include chemical cleaning and degreasing, stripping or shot blasting, as well as conversion treatment such as phosphating or passivation. The preparation sequence is defined according to exposure conditions and customer specifications.

What are the specific benefits and applications of your dielectric powder coating services, particularly for electrical insulation on components used in the electronics or energy sectors?
Dielectric powder coating provides reliable electrical insulation while offering durable mechanical and corrosion protection.
It is particularly suitable for components used in the electronics and energy sectors, where insulation, robustness and durability are essential. The coating system is defined according to functional requirements, usage constraints and customer specifications.
What quality control measures and testing methods (e.g., paint thickness/DFT measurement, adhesion tests, gloss measurement) do you implement for your industrial paint coating processes to meet industry standards or customer specifications?
Our industrial painting processes are based on quality controls at every stage of the process.
They include measuring paint thickness (DFT), adhesion tests and, where required, appearance checks such as gloss. These checks ensure compliance with applicable standards and customer specifications, with traceability tailored to industrial requirements.
